libsepol: do not #include <sys/cdefs.h> ratbert90 submitted this patch via https://github.com/SELinuxProject/selinux/issues/19. Apparently musl does not provide sys/cdefs.h, see http://wiki.musl-libc.org/wiki/FAQ#Q:_I.27m_trying_to_compile_something_against_musl_and_I_get_error_messages_about_sys.2Fcdefs.h. libsepol,checkpolicy: convert rangetrans and filenametrans to hashtabs range transition and name-based type transition rules were originally simple unordered lists. They were converted to hashtabs in the kernel by commit 2f3e82d694d3d7a2db019db1bb63385fbc1066f3 ("selinux: convert range transition list to a hashtab") and by commit 2463c26d50adc282d19317013ba0ff473823ca47 ("SELinux: put name based create rules in a hashtable"), but left unchanged in libsepol and checkpolicy. Convert libsepol and checkpolicy to use the same hashtabs as the kernel for the range transitions and name-based type transitions. With this change and the preceding one, it is possible to directly compare a policy file generated by libsepol/checkpolicy and the kernel-generated /sys/fs/selinux/policy pseudo file after normalizing them both through checkpolicy. To do so, you can run the following sequence of commands: checkpolicy -M -b /etc/selinux/targeted/policy/policy.30 -o policy.1 checkpolicy -M -b /sys/fs/selinux/policy -o policy.2 cmp policy.1 policy.2 Normalizing the two files via checkpolicy is still necessary to ensure consistent ordering of the avtab entries. There may still be potential for other areas of difference, e.g. xperms entries may lack a well-defined order. Signed-off-by: Stephen Smalley <sds@tycho.nsa.gov>
